Mammalia - Perissodactyla - Equidae
Alternative combination: Hipparion gidleyi
Full reference: J. C. Merriam. 1915. New species of the Hipparion group from the Pacific Coast and Great Basin provinces of North America. University of California Publications, Bulletin of the Department of Geology 9(1):1-8
Belongs to Neohipparion according to B. J. MacFadden 1998
See also Hulbert 1987, Macdonald 1992, MacFadden 1984, Merriam 1915, Osborn 1918, Stirton 1939 and Stirton 1940
Sister taxa: Neohipparion affine, Neohipparion eurystyle, Neohipparion leptode, Neohipparion sanjuanensis, Neohipparion trampasense
Type specimen: UCMP 21382, a tooth (·A third upper molar, m*, of the left side). Its type locality is Lawler Ranch, which is in a Miocene terrestrial horizon in the Petaluma Formation of California.
Ecology: ground dwelling grazer
Distribution:
• Hemphillian of United States (1: Oklahoma collection)
• Miocene of United States (2: California)
Total: 3 collections each including a single occurrence
